The Ferrari F430 might be one generation behind the supercars that can be currently found on the market, but this doesn’t mean that it out of the spotlights. Oh no. Aftermarket developers are still paying attention to the F430 and we’re here to give you the latest example of this.
We are talking about an yellow F430, which has been played with by US specialist Advance One Wheels. The supercar was fitted with a set of ADV5.2.1SL (Super Light) rims, which use a five double-spoke design that increase the car’s visual “wow!” factor.
The F430 is dressed in yellow, while the rims come in a dark finish and allows us to see matching yellow calipers, which means that this baby benefits from ceramic stopping power, which only makes the car hotter.
